• 数据库简单 增删改查复习


    <?php
    @$con = mysql_connect('localhost','zsg','123456');

    if(!$con){
    die('Could not connect:' . mysql_error());
    }
    mysql_select_db("my_db",$con);
    //建立一个数据库
    /* if(mysql_query("create database my_db",$con)){
    echo "database created";
    }else{
    echo "Error creating database :" . mysql_error();
    } */

    //建立一个数据表 CREATE TABLE
    //主键字段永远要编入索引,这条规则没有例外,你必须对主键字段进行索引。这样数据库引擎才能快速定位给予改建数值的行 对于主键 还需添加NOT NULL 设置。
    /* mysql_select_db("my_db",$con);
    $sql = "CREATE TABLE Persons(
    Id int(11) primary key auto_increment,
    Firstname varchar(15),
    Lastname varchar(15),
    Age int(11)
    )";
    if(mysql_query($sql,$con)){
    echo "TABLE Persons created successfully";
    } */

    //向数据库插入新纪录
    /* $query = mysql_query("insert into Persons(Firstname,Lastname,Age)VALUES('张三','李四','5')");
    if($query){
    echo "成功插入数据";
    } */

    //向数据库查询数据,以表格的形式输出
    //
    //对于result的处理
    //where 指定条件查询
    //order by 排序
    $result = mysql_query("select * from Persons order by Age ASC");
    var_dump($result);
    echo '<center><table border="" width="300px" height="200px" style="text-align:center; background-color:yellow;">';
    echo "<tr><th>Firstname</th><th>Lastname</th><th>Age</th></tr>";
    while($row = mysql_fetch_array($result)){
    echo "<tr>";
    echo "<td>".$row['Firstname']."</td>";
    echo "<td>".$row['Lastname']."</td>";
    echo "<td>".$row['Age']."</td>";
    echo "</tr>";
    }
    echo '</table></center>';


    //对数据库进行更新
    /* $sql = mysql_query("update Persons set Age = '25' where Firstname = '张三' and Lastname = '李四'");
    if($sql){
    echo "成功更新数据";
    } */
    mysql_close($con);

    // Internet 信息服务器 (IIS) Internet information services

  • 相关阅读:
    mysql服务的注册,启动、停止、注销。 [delphi代码实现]
    java初始化
    git的使用
    jmeter测试
    Linux上安装Redis
    java多线程
    设计模式之装饰着模式
    IO流之字符流知识总结
    IO流之字节流知识总结
    java File类
  • 原文地址:https://www.cnblogs.com/zhongshenggen/p/5892184.html
Copyright © 2020-2023  润新知